Abstract

A sliding bearing to be immersed in molten metal has low friction and long life. The bearing is provided with a solid particle trap portion for preventing solid particles in the molten metal from penetrating between sliding surfaces of the shaft and the bearing and removing the solid particles. Abrasive wear and an increase in friction, caused by biting of the solid particles into the sliding surfaces can be prevented. A continuous hot-dip plating apparatus employs the sliding bearing in the molten metal.
